Vauxhall Corsa Key Replacement Cost

The cost of replacing your Vauxhall Corsa car key is contingent on a myriad of factors. This includes the make, model and year of your car.

The majority of the time, a newer vehicle with transponder chips in the key will be more expensive to replace than a previous car. This is due to the fact that they require specialized equipment and expertise to program them.

Cost of Programming

The cost of programming the Vauxhall Corsa key replacement varies on the type of key that you want replaced. Transponder keys, for example, are much more expensive to replace than manual keys since they have a chip within them that needs to be programmed to work.

If you're replacing a transponder lock you could expect to pay anywhere from $150 to $225 depending on the service you choose to get it programmed. A locksmith is an alternative to an auto dealer to replace the transponder key.

A blank key is a great method to reduce the cost of replacing keys. They can be found on the internet for a fraction of the price, but you'll need that they're made for your specific model and year of Vauxhall.

In addition to saving money, obtaining keys that are blank can assist you in avoiding having to get your Vauxhall Corsa repaired or replaced. This is because dealers are typically reluctant to provide customers with an extra Vauxhall Corsa keys when they're experiencing problems.

Most locksmiths are able to program your Vauxhall Corsa key for about 20% less than the price you'd pay a dealer. However, it's important for you to know that this is a difficult to complete.



First, locate locksmiths with the appropriate equipment. This will allow them to access your vehicle's computer and program the new key.

It is also necessary to display your vehicle identification number (VIN) which can be found on the driver's side door and on the dashboard. You can get this number from the owner's manual, or you can contact the manufacturer of your Vauxhall Corsa to request it.

Finally, they will have to see your V5 logbook, as well as your driving license. It's best to keep these documents in a safe location as you might require them in the future.
